Re: OER DASH PAD who ordered one before they were discontinued at this price? $225
A guy with an IROC that I see at cruise nights has one in his.. I didn’t notice until he pointed it out. He got his replacement dash from Hawks as well as the replacement headliner.
The dash pad had a slightly different grain and was hard plastic as opposed to the squishy feel of my original dash but it didn’t stand out as not fitting well or not being original unless you take a closer look. Maybe it’s just the cover.. but it looked good..

Re: OER DASH PAD who ordered one before they were discontinued at this price? $225
I bought a OER pad for mine about 4 years ago....I paid around 345 bucks for mine, so 224 is a smoking deal!! Wish I'd got mine at that price. No issues at all with mine and it looks fine. Every bit as strong as the stock dash if not better!
- I do remember that I had to drill the holes for the mounting screws though....no biggie, just take your time, mark it right and don't drill too deep!!
